Paperback. Condizione: New. Print on Demand. This book details the history of school reform and the theories which have sought to implement it. It discusses the effectiveness of the project method, which emphasizes student involvement, creativity, and initiative, within the classroom. The author analyzes the project method and other methods of education in order to highlight the potential and limitations of each approach, also delving into relevant topics such as the advantages of having students work in groups versus individually, and the balance that must be struck between teacher and student authority within the classroom. The book includes examples of projects within various grade levels, and includes tips for teachers on how to foster a project-based learning environment. This book is an essential tool for reevaluating the role of project-based learning within the modern classroom.
